Light Control and Interior Comfort
Another significant advantage of tinted glass is its ability to control natural light. By selectively filtering sunlight, tinted glass can reduce glare, making interior spaces more comfortable for occupants. This is particularly important in environments that require digital screens or delicate materials, where excessive sunlight can be disruptive. Moreover, tinted glass can help in regulating indoor temperatures by minimizing heat gain from sun exposure. This energy-efficient characteristic not only promotes sustainability by reducing the need for artificial cooling but also aids in lowering energy bills.
Privacy and Security
Privacy is a fundamental consideration in both residential and commercial design. Tinted glass provides a practical solution by obscuring the view from the outside while allowing those inside to enjoy unobstructed views of the surroundings. This feature is especially valuable in urban settings where buildings are often in close proximity. Additionally, some types of tinted glass enhance security; the added thickness can deter break-ins, allowing for peace of mind without compromising aesthetics.
Sustainable Design Practices
As the architectural industry increasingly embraces sustainable practices, tinted glass has emerged as a valuable component of eco-friendly design. Many tinted glass products are now produced using energy-efficient manufacturing processes and are available with low-emissivity (low-E) coatings that enhance thermal insulation. By implementing tinted glass, architects can create structures that not only meet aesthetic desires but also adhere to sustainability goals and reduce their carbon footprint over time.
